How do audio engineers balance AI-driven noise reduction with preserving natural sound quality?

Audio engineers use AI-driven noise reduction tools to minimize unwanted background noise while maintaining the integrity of the original audio. These tools often provide adjustable parameters that allow engineers to fine-tune the balance between noise reduction and natural sound quality.
Example Concept: AI-driven noise reduction involves analyzing the audio spectrum to identify and suppress noise frequencies without affecting the desired sound. Engineers adjust thresholds and reduction levels to ensure that the natural characteristics of the audio, such as voice timbre and ambient nuances, are preserved. This process often includes iterative listening tests and parameter tweaking to achieve an optimal balance.

- AI noise reduction tools like those in Descript or Adobe Audition offer real-time previews to assess changes instantly.
- It's crucial to avoid over-processing, which can lead to artifacts or a synthetic sound.
- Engineers often combine AI tools with traditional EQ and compression techniques for best results.
